Formula in Code Format

python
def mist_dilution(volume_mist_ml, concentration_essential_oil_pct, desired_concentration_pct):
"""
Calculate the amount of diluent (usually water or alcohol) to add to a mist to achieve a desired concentration.

:param volume_mist_ml: Total volume of the mist in milliliters
:param concentration_essential_oil_pct: Current concentration of the essential oil in the mist as a percentage
:param desired_concentration_pct: Desired concentration of the essential oil in the mist as a percentage
:return: Volume of diluent to add in milliliters
"""
essential_oil_ml = (concentration_essential_oil_pct / 100) * volume_mist_ml
desired_total_volume_ml = essential_oil_ml / (desired_concentration_pct / 100)
volume_diluent_to_add_ml = desired_total_volume_ml - volume_mist_ml
return volume_diluent_to_add_ml

Categories of Face and Body Mist Dilution

Category Concentration Range (%) Interpretation
Light 0.5 – 1.0 Subtle scent, ideal for sensitive skin or close quarters.
Medium 1.1 – 2.0 Noticeable yet not overwhelming, suited for daily use.
Strong 2.1 – 3.0 Potent, lasting fragrance, best for those who prefer a pronounced aroma.

Limitations of Accuracy

1. Variability in Essential Oil Concentration

  • Essential oils can vary in concentration from batch to batch, affecting the final dilution accuracy.

2. Measurement Errors

  • Small errors in measuring volumes can lead to significant discrepancies in the desired concentration.

3. Evaporation Loss

  • Volatile components of essential oils may evaporate during mixing, altering the concentration.

4. Temperature Effects

  • Temperature changes can affect the density and volume of liquids, impacting dilution calculations.

FAQs on Face and Body Mist Dilution Calculator

1. How do I choose the right concentration for my face and body mist?

The right concentration depends on personal preference and intended use. Start with a light concentration and adjust based on your skin’s sensitivity and scent strength preference.

2. Can I dilute my mist with anything other than water?

Yes, you can use alcohol or a carrier oil, depending on the desired effect and solubility of the essential oils.

3. How often should I recalibrate my calculator for accurate measurements?

If you’re using a digital tool, ensure it’s updated regularly. For manual calculations, check your formulas and measurements for consistency periodically.

4. What’s the best way to store diluted mists?

Store in a cool, dark place in airtight containers to preserve the fragrance and prevent contamination.

5. Can I mix different essential oils in one mist?

Yes, but ensure their combined concentration does not exceed the safe limit for skin application.

6. Is there a maximum concentration I should not exceed?

Typically, a 3% concentration is considered safe for adult use on the body, but always perform a patch test first.

7. How do I adjust the calculator for different units of measurement?

Convert your measurements to match the calculator’s required units, typically milliliters (ml) and percentages (%).

8. What should I do if my skin reacts to a diluted mist?

Discontinue use immediately and consult a healthcare professional if necessary. Always patch test before full application.
